Output 590f56dc6917d39a0f407c58abb80121a399268c03a6de33935fbd01024825ab:0

value
460755
script pubkey
OP_0 OP_PUSHBYTES_20 85c8d6247f53b93f9c322022cede16977c4360e8
address
bc1qshydvfrl2wunl8pjyq3vahskja7yxc8gzvzcpd
transaction
590f56dc6917d39a0f407c58abb80121a399268c03a6de33935fbd01024825ab